Q: What are the key features of the GE 12,000 BTU Through-the-Wall Air Conditioner with Heat (Model AJEM12DWH)?
A: This unit provides 12,000 BTUs of cooling capacity and 10,600 BTUs of electric heating, suitable for medium-sized rooms. It features built-in WiFi powered by SmartHQ™, allowing remote control via smartphone. The true built-in design ensures a seamless fit with minimal extension into the room. Additional features include electronic touch controls, a large LCD auto-dimming display, and an energy saver mode for efficient operation.
Q: Is the GE AJEM12DWH air conditioner still available for purchase?
A: This model has been discontinued due to the mandatory shift to R32 refrigerant, as per the AIM Act, beginning January 1st, 2025. It may still be available at select retailers while supplies last.

Q:What are the dimensions of the GE AJEM12DWH air conditioner?
A: The unit measures 15 5/8 inches in height, 26 inches in width, and 21 13/16 inches in depth.

Q: Is there an energy saver mode on this air conditioner?
A: Yes, the unit includes an energy saver feature that temporarily shuts off the air conditioner when the room reaches a certain temperature, preventing over-cooling and conserving energy.

Q: What type of refrigerant does the GE AJEM12DWH use?
A: This model uses R410A refrigerant. Due to regulatory changes requiring a shift to R32 refrigerant, this model has been discontinued.
